Unlocking the Genetic Code: A Glimpse into Genomics

[Source: Wikipedia]

Genomics, the study of an individual’s complete set of DNA, has transcended from being a mere scientific curiosity to a practical tool in healthcare. With the decoding of the human genome, scientists gained access to an intricate library of genetic information that holds the key to understanding the unique factors that shape our health and predisposition to diseases.

Drugs affect people differently and we’re increasingly understanding why. For many of us, it’s down to our genes.

Customizing Treatment: A Breakthrough in Patient Care

Imagine a scenario where doctors can craft treatment plans that align precisely with a patient’s genetic makeup, maximizing effectiveness and minimizing side effects. Genomics has made this a reality. By analyzing an individual’s genetic variations, healthcare providers can pinpoint the most suitable medications and therapies, ensuring that treatments are not just effective, but also tailored to the patient’s biological nuances.

One remarkable example of genomics in action is the field of oncology. Through genomic profiling of tumours, oncologists can identify specific genetic mutations driving the growth of cancer cells. Armed with this information, they can administer targeted therapies that directly address the underlying genetic abnormalities, leading to improved outcomes and a higher quality of life for cancer patients.

Predicting Disease Risks: A Glimpse into the Future

While treatment customization is undoubtedly transformative, genomics also offers the tantalizing prospect of predicting disease risks before they manifest. By analyzing an individual’s genetic predispositions, doctors can identify the likelihood of developing certain diseases, such as diabetes, heart disease, and certain types of cancer. This proactive approach empowers individuals to make informed lifestyle choices and undergo regular screenings, potentially preventing the onset of diseases altogether.

Challenges and Future Prospects: Navigating the Path Ahead

As promising as genomics is, it comes with its share of challenges. One major hurdle is the cost and accessibility of genomic testing. Currently, such testing can be expensive, limiting its availability to a privileged few. Bridging this gap to ensure equitable access to precision medicine is a critical task for the healthcare community and policymakers.

In Nigeria, where healthcare infrastructure and resources vary, the adoption of genomics faces unique challenges. However, with concerted efforts, these challenges can be overcome. Collaborations between research institutions, healthcare providers, and policymakers are essential to creating a robust genomics ecosystem that caters to the diverse needs of the population.
